Article Title:
GlassWorm Escalates: 72 Malicious Open VSX Extensions Target Developers
In a significant escalation of the GlassWorm campaign, cybersecurity researchers have identified 72 additional malicious extensions infiltrating the Open VSX registry. These extensions, masquerading as popular developer tools, pose a substantial threat to the software development community.
Evolution of the GlassWorm Campaign
Initially detected in October 2025, GlassWorm is a sophisticated malware campaign targeting Visual Studio Code (VS Code) extensions. The malware is designed to steal sensitive information, drain cryptocurrency wallets, and exploit infected systems for further malicious activities. The latest findings indicate a strategic shift in the campaign’s propagation methods, enhancing its stealth and effectiveness.
New Propagation Techniques
The recent iteration of GlassWorm introduces a novel approach to spreading malware. Instead of embedding malicious code directly into each extension, the attackers now exploit the extensionPack and extensionDependencies features. This tactic allows initially benign extensions to later pull in malicious ones, effectively turning trusted packages into delivery vehicles for malware. This method capitalizes on the trust established with users, making detection and prevention more challenging.
Scope of the Attack
Since January 31, 2026, at least 72 malicious Open VSX extensions have been identified. These extensions mimic widely used developer utilities, including linters, formatters, code runners, and tools for AI-powered coding assistants like Clade Code and Google Antigravity. Some of the compromised extensions include:
– angular-studio.ng-angular-extension
– crotoapp.vscode-xml-extension
– gvotcha.claude-code-extension
– mswincx.antigravity-cockpit
– tamokill12.foundry-pdf-extension
– turbobase.sql-turbo-tool
– vce-brendan-studio-eich.js-debuger-vscode
Open VSX has since taken steps to remove these malicious extensions from the registry.
Technical Details and Obfuscation
The latest GlassWorm variants exhibit increased obfuscation techniques and rotate Solana wallets to evade detection. By leveraging Solana transactions as a dead drop resolver, the malware fetches command-and-control (C2) servers, enhancing its resilience against takedown efforts. Additionally, the use of invisible Unicode characters to conceal malicious code within the extensions adds another layer of stealth, making it difficult for developers to identify compromised packages.
Implications for Developers
The GlassWorm campaign underscores the growing threat of supply chain attacks targeting the developer ecosystem. By compromising widely used tools and utilities, attackers can infiltrate development environments, leading to potential data breaches, financial losses, and further propagation of malware.
Recommendations for Mitigation
To protect against such threats, developers and organizations should adopt the following measures:
1. Vigilant Extension Management: Regularly review and audit installed extensions, especially those that have been recently updated or added.
2. Source Verification: Ensure extensions are sourced from reputable publishers and verify their authenticity before installation.
3. Monitoring for Anomalies: Implement monitoring tools to detect unusual activities within the development environment, such as unexpected network connections or unauthorized data access.
4. Regular Updates: Keep all development tools and extensions updated to benefit from the latest security patches and fixes.
5. Security Training: Educate developers about the risks associated with third-party extensions and the importance of cybersecurity best practices.
Conclusion
The resurgence and evolution of the GlassWorm campaign highlight the critical need for heightened security measures within the software development community. By staying informed and adopting proactive security practices, developers can mitigate the risks posed by such sophisticated supply chain attacks.